Lengvai ištaisykite ankstesnės komandos rašybos klaidą naudodami karatų (^) simbolį


Ar kada nors įvedėte komandą ir puolėte spustelėti Enter, tačiau pamatėte, kad joje buvo rašybos klaida? Nors galite naudoti rodykles aukštyn ir žemyn komandų istorijoje naršyti ir rašybos klaidą redaguoti, yra paprastesnis ir greitesnis būdas.

Nepraleiskite: „Linux“ istorijos komandos galia „Bash Shell“

Šiame patarime apžvelgsime paprastą ir patogų būdą, kaip išspręsti komandinės eilutės rašybos klaidą, tarkime, kad norėjote pamatyti, ar prievado 22 yra paslauga, bet netyčia įvedėte nestat . vietoj netstat.

Rašybos klaidą galite lengvai pakeisti tinkama komanda ir vykdyti ją taip:

nestat -npltu | grep 22
^nestat^netstat

Teisingai. Naudodami du karatų ženklus (po jų turėtų būti atitinkamai rašybos klaida ir tinkamas žodis), galite ištaisyti rašybos klaidą ir po to automatiškai paleisti komandą.

Turite atkreipti dėmesį, kad šis metodas veikia tik su ankstesne komanda (paskutine įvykdyta komanda), kai bandysite ištaisyti anksčiau vykdytos komandos rašybos klaidą, apvalkalas išspausdins klaidą.

Santrauka

Tai puikus patarimas, galintis padėti pašalinti laiko švaistymo tendencijas, nes, kaip matėte, daug lengviau ir greičiau nei slinkti komandų istorijoje rasti ir ištaisyti rašybos klaidą.

Viskas, ką jums reikia padaryti, tai ištaisyti rašybos klaidą naudojant karatų ženklus, paspausti mygtuką Enter ir teisinga komanda bus įvykdyta automatiškai.

Gali būti, kad yra keletas kitų būdų, kaip ištaisyti komandų eilutės rašybos klaidas. Būtų labai įdomu išmokti naujų ir galite pasidalinti su mumis viskuo, ką atradote, naudodami toliau pateiktą komentarų formą.

Kitame „Linux“ patarime sistemos administratoriams apžvelgsime, kaip vienu metu paleisti komandą. Iki tol palaikykite ryšį su Tecmint.